| description | Introduction: Breast cancer is one of the most important causes of mortality in
women. Various factors are involved in the development of cancer, including
viruses. Toll-like receptors (TLRs) have an essential role in the innate immune
system. The present study investigated the relationship between TLR2
rs5743708 polymorphisms and Torque teno virus (TTV) infection with breast
cancer. Methods: Blood samples from 80 women with breast cancer and 80
healthy women were collected, and after DNA extraction, the presence of TTV
was investigated by a PCR assay and polymorphism in the TLR2 gene
(rs5743708) was explored using the PCR-RFLP method. Also, the physical and
chemical properties of TLR2 protein in the two wild and mutant forms were
analyzed using the ExPASy database. Results: Statistical analysis showed that
there was no significant relationship between the age and TTV infection; TTV
infection and breast cancer; the grade of cancer, and TTV infection; while there
were significant relationships between rs5743708 polymorphisms and breast
cancer; GG genotype and increased incidence of cancer; TTV infection and
rs5743708 polymorphisms. Also, instability index, aliphatic index, grand
average of hydropathicity, and molecular weight of TLR2 protein varied in wild
and mutant states. Conclusions: Although there was no significant relationship
between TTV infection and breast cancer, the rs5743708 polymorphisms might
be involved in TTV infection and breast cancer. |
